An autonomous penetration-testing agent for business platforms such as Salesforce, ServiceNow, Jira, Confluence, SharePoint, and Nextcloud. Penetration testing is an authorized security check that looks for ways a system could be attacked.

In plain words
What is it for?
Use it for authorized security testing of the listed business platforms with the connected fastcmp tools.
Why use it?
It provides a focused security tester for several enterprise platforms instead of treating every application as the same. The supplied information does not describe its exact tests or reports.

Per session 43 Only the description is in the session, so the agent can decide to use it. The body loads when it is invoked.
When invoked 6,642 The whole file, excluding the scripts and references it only reads on demand.
Security scan A 2 findings. Scan, not verified.
Origin unknown No closer match found in the catalogue.
Token cost

What it costs to keep this loaded

Counted locally with the o200k_base tokenizer, which is exact for GPT models; Claude uses its own tokenizer and its counts differ. Treat this as one consistent yardstick across the catalogue rather than a bill. Prices are per million input tokens.

business-platforms scanned grade A with 2 findings against 26 rules in 11 categories — prompt injection, anti-refusal, data exfiltration, privilege escalation, supply chain, agent snooping, system-prompt leakage, SSRF and excessive agency — measured 5d ago.

A static scan of the body, not an audit. Every finding is printed with the line that produced it so you can judge whether it matters here. A mod is markdown that instructs an agent; that is exactly why what it instructs is worth reading.

Sends data to an external URLlowData exfiltration

A POST to an outside endpoint may be telemetry or may be exfiltration; either way the mod talks to somewhere, and you should know where.

curl -sk 'https://<community>/s/sfsites/aura' --data 'message=<aura getRecords descriptor>&aura.context=<ctx>&aura.token=undefined'

Downgraded: this mod is about security review, or the phrase is quoted, so it is likely naming the pattern rather than instructing it.

Makes network callslowCapability

Not a fault in itself. Listed so you know the mod talks to something, and to what.
